About BMC Software, Inc.
BMC Software, Inc. develops and markets enterprise software for IT service management, automation, and optimization. Founded in 1980 and headquartered in Houston, Texas, the company provides solutions for mainframe, cloud, and DevOps environments, helping organizations manage digital operations, secure assets, and deliver services efficiently. Its portfolio includes Helix, Control-M, and MainView platforms. BMC serves Fortune 500 companies and government agencies across finance, healthcare, and telecommunications sectors, focusing on reducing IT costs, ensuring compliance, and accelerating innovation through automated workflows and data-driven insights.
